搞游戏,游戏中的策略与战斗艺术

小编

小伙伴们,你是否也有过这样的梦想:亲手打造一款属于自己的游戏,让世界因你的创意而精彩?搞游戏,这不仅仅是一句口号,更是一种态度,一种追求。今天,就让我带你一起走进这个充满奇幻与挑战的世界,揭开游戏制作的神秘面纱。

灵感闪现:从生活中的点滴汲取创意

搞游戏,第一步就是要找到你的灵感。这灵感可能来源于你的一次旅行,也可能来源于你的一部喜欢的电影,甚至是你日常生活中的一个小细节。比如,你可能会被《星际穿越》中的黑洞吸引,从而萌生出一个关于太空探险的游戏想法。

想象玩家在游戏中穿梭于不同的星球,寻找资源,解决难题。这样的设定是不是很酷?所以,搞游戏的第一步,就是让你的大脑开始运转,从生活中寻找那些能激发你创作灵感的元素。

玩法设计:让游戏与众不同

找到了灵感,接下来就是设计游戏的玩法。玩法是游戏的核心,它决定了游戏是否能够吸引玩家。那么,如何让你的游戏玩法与众不同呢?

你可以尝试以下几种方法:

1. 战斗系统:设计一个独特的战斗系统,让玩家在游戏中体验到前所未有的战斗快感。

2. 解谜元素:加入一些有趣的谜题,让玩家在游戏中不断挑战自己的智慧。

3. 资源管理:设计一个资源管理系统,让玩家在游戏中学会如何合理分配资源。

记住,你的目标是让玩家在游戏中获得成就感,所以,设计游戏玩法时,一定要考虑玩家的感受。

选择合适的游戏引擎:Unity、Unreal Engine还是Godot?

搞游戏,离不开游戏引擎。市面上有很多免费的游戏引擎,比如Unity、Unreal Engine、Godot等。那么,如何选择合适的游戏引擎呢?

1. Unity:适合初学者,社区活跃,教程丰富。

2. Unreal Engine:图形表现力强大,适合制作高质量3D游戏。

3. Godot:轻量级,适合2D游戏开发。

根据自己的需求和技能水平,选择一个合适的游戏引擎,让你的游戏制作之旅更加顺畅。

学习编程知识:掌握游戏开发的基石

搞游戏,编程知识是必不可少的。虽然有些引擎支持可视化编程,但了解编程的基础概念,能够让你更好地理解游戏的逻辑。

Python、C和C都是常用的编程语言。你可以通过在线学习平台,如Codecademy、Coursera等,学习这些编程语言。

实战演练:从Pygame开始

想要快速入门游戏开发,Pygame是一个不错的选择。Pygame是一个跨平台的Python库,用于开发2D游戏和多媒体应用。

通过Pygame,你可以轻松实现一个简单的弹跳球游戏,或者尝试开发更复杂的互动游戏。Pygame的核心功能包括图像处理、声音处理、事件处理、动画控制等。

案例分享:《One Dreamer》:让玩家成为游戏设计师

《One Dreamer》是一款让玩家能够操纵周围世界并编辑冒险游戏源代码的软件。通过这款软件,玩家可以实现自己毕生的梦想。

这款游戏打破了传统游戏开发的模式,让玩家成为游戏设计师。这种创新的理念,无疑为游戏开发带来了新的可能性。

搞游戏,不仅是一种技能,更是一种态度。只要你愿意投入时间和精力,掌握一些基本的技能,就能自己动手做出一款有趣的游戏。让我们一起,开启这段充满奇幻与挑战的游戏制作之旅吧!